LangGraph - Pros & Cons
Pros
- ✓Graph-based state machine gives precise control over execution flow with conditional branching, loops, and cycles
- ✓Built-in checkpointing enables time-travel debugging, human-in-the-loop approval, and fault-tolerant resume from any step
- ✓Subgraph composition lets you build complex multi-agent systems from reusable, independently testable graph components
- ✓LangSmith integration provides production-grade tracing with visibility into every node execution and state transition
- ✓First-class streaming support with token-by-token, node-by-node, and custom event streaming modes
Cons
- ✗Steeper learning curve than role-based frameworks — requires understanding state machines, reducers, and graph theory concepts
- ✗Tight coupling to LangChain ecosystem means adopting LangChain's abstractions even if you only want the graph runtime
- ✗Graph definitions can become verbose for simple workflows that would be 10 lines in a linear framework
- ✗LangGraph Platform pricing adds significant cost for deployment infrastructure beyond the open-source core
LangSmith - Pros & Cons
Pros
- ✓Comprehensive observability with detailed trace visualization
- ✓Native MCP support for universal agent tool deployment
- ✓Generous free tier for individual developers and small projects
- ✓No-code Agent Builder reduces technical barriers
- ✓Managed deployment infrastructure with production-ready scaling
- ✓Strong integration with entire LangChain ecosystem
Cons
- ✗Primarily designed for LangChain applications (limited framework support)
- ✗Steep pricing jump from Plus to Enterprise tier
- ✗Pay-as-you-go model can become expensive for high-volume applications
- ✗Enterprise features require annual contracts
- ✗14-day retention on base traces may be insufficient for some use cases
